When training your cat to use the cat flap, begin by putting out some of their favourite treats. Use a cloth or a blanket with the scent of your cat to get him used to the flap's texture. You can also bring them into your living space with treats and encourage them to walk across the flap. It is best to begin training your cat in the spring or summer months, since autumn and winter can cause drafts that make it difficult for them to get through the flap.

Installing a cat flap can be a simple task for the majority of wooden doors, uPVC doors and double-glazed patio door panels. It is recommended that you employ an expert cat flap installer if you wish to install the cat flap on glass panels. Cutting through a glass door or window can be difficult without the right tools and understanding. A skilled cat flap fitter employs a jigsaw in order to cut out a precise opening, based on the manufacturer's guidelines for dimensions and positioning. They then seal the hole to minimize drafts and moisture infiltration, and to protect the door or Window cat flap from damage.
